The Office of Naval Research (ONR) is seeking support for the development and enhancement of a comprehensive data and analytics environment. The work primarily involves Information Technology (IT) services related to data, analytics, visualization, business intelligence, and data science. The goal is to provide a trusted solution and information source for ONR and the Naval Research Enterprise (NRE) mission stakeholders and customers. The scope of work includes program and project management, stakeholder engagement, technical expertise, business intelligence systems, cloud and hosting support, data support, data science and analytics, and data visualization.

The contractor will be responsible for developing program and project management plans, including an integrated master plan and schedule. They will also provide financial and execution reporting to monitor the status of the program and projects. Stakeholder, customer, and end user engagement will be facilitated through various channels such as meetings, workshops, demonstrations, and user training. Technical expertise will be required to evaluate potential solutions and provide recommendations for improvement.

The contractor will also support the development and maintenance of business intelligence systems, databases, and web-based applications. This includes data modeling, extraction, transformation, and load processes to ensure timely availability of data. Certification and accreditation of the data and analytics environments will be necessary to maintain operational capability.

Cloud and hosting support will involve identifying, provisioning, monitoring, and overseeing cloud services or other hosting solutions used in the data and analytics solution. Data support activities include identifying, securing, curating, modeling, maintaining, provisioning, and utilizing data from various sources. The contractor will also perform data science and analytics tasks such as analyzing complex data to provide insights for decision-making.

Data visualization capabilities will be developed to represent complex information in a user-friendly manner. This includes interactive visuals and graphics that aid in understanding patterns and trends in the data. The contractor will utilize authorized tools such as Tableau, Python libraries for visualization, JavaScript visualization libraries like d3.js, and R/ggplot/Shiny.

Overall, the contractor will support the ONR in establishing and maintaining a comprehensive data and analytics environment that enhances decision-making and mission outcomes for the Naval Research Enterprise.
